Reimagining Chicago’s Thompson Center for the next generation

Google has officially established a new corporate office location within the Thompson Center in Chicago. This move marks the transition of the historic architectural site into a functional Google workspace.

Full Fact Overview

The Thompson Center, formerly the James R. Thompson Center, is a postmodern building designed by Helmut Jahn. Google's acquisition and renovation of this site represent a strategic expansion of its physical footprint in the Midwest. The project involves retrofitting a public-sector architectural landmark into a private-sector corporate office, emphasizing the integration of existing structural design with modern workplace requirements.
